Top St Martine | Reviews & Ratings | comparemela.com

St martine in United states - 18201/ near luzerne

St martine in United states - 10022/ near new-york

St martine in United states - 70517/ near st-martin

St martine in India - 689695/ near kollam

St martine in India - 691504/ near kollam

St martine in Germany - 21635/ near jork

St martine in United states - 02723/ near fall-river

St martine in Puerto rico - 33135/ near miami-dade

St martine in United states - 02723/ near fall-river

St martine in United states - 89169/ near clark